Lamentations 3:45 (KJV)
“Thou hast made us as the offscouring and refuse in the midst of the people.”

Lamentations 3 — surrounding verses
Let us search and try our ways, and turn again to the LORD.
41Let us lift up our heart with our hands unto God in the heavens.
42We have transgressed and have rebelled: thou hast not pardoned.
43Thou hast covered with anger, and persecuted us: thou hast slain, thou hast not pitied.
44Thou hast covered thyself with a cloud, that our prayer should not pass through.
Thou hast made us as the offscouring and refuse in the midst of the people.
All our enemies have opened their mouths against us.
47Fear and a snare is come upon us, desolation and destruction.
48Mine eye runneth down with rivers of water for the destruction of the daughter of my people.
49Mine eye trickleth down, and ceaseth not, without any intermission.
50Till the LORD look down, and behold from heaven.
